What Happened
The recent unveiling of the Mahakali teaser has triggered an immediate and vocal reaction from the internet community. While the overall production quality of the teaser has been a subject of positive discussion, the specific appearance of Akshaye Khanna has dominated the discourse.
Viewers have taken to various platforms to express their impressions regarding the actor’s physical manifestation as Shukracharya. The consensus among the digital audience suggests that the costume, makeup, and overall demeanor adopted for the role have created a striking visual impact that commands attention.

Background
Akshaye Khanna is widely recognized for his selective approach to roles and his ability to inhabit complex characters. His decision to participate in Mahakali as Shukracharya marks a notable addition to his filmography, particularly given the mythological context of the narrative.
Shukracharya, a figure of profound significance in traditional lore, requires a nuanced performance that balances authority with the mystical elements inherent to the character. The teaser provides a brief yet potent glimpse into how Khanna has interpreted these requirements, utilizing his established acting range to convey the gravity of the figure.
